What is RSS? RSS (Really Simple Syndication) is an XML-based format for sharing and distributing internet content, such as news headlines. Using an RSS reader, you can view data feeds from various news sources, such as symphonymed.com, which include headlines, summaries, and links to full stories. How do I access the RSS feed with a news reader? RSS readers (also know as aggregators) download and display RSS news feeds for you. Various free and commercial RSS readers are available on the internet. While some readers are standalone programs, services exist to allow you to add an RSS feed to a web page. Yahoo!™ users can add RSS feed to their MyYahoo! page and Google™ users can add the RSS feed to their Google™ homepage. Other services exist which may suit your needs better.
